Story summary
- U.S. President Donald Trump warned Iran to accept a "very fair" deal as U.S. negotiators prepare for talks in Pakistan.
- He threatened to knock out every power plant and every bridge in Iran if no agreement is reached before the two-week ceasefire ends.
- Iran fired on vessels in the Strait of Hormuz, violating the ceasefire and escalating tensions.
- Iran has rejected the latest talks, citing U.S. demands as excessive.
- Preparations for the U.S. delegation's arrival in Islamabad are underway with heightened security.
